If you need Unity3D you need to follow the procedure below.
http://alien.slackbook.org/blog/pipelig ... -browsers/

but setting

Code: Select all

porteus root @ :/ home / guest # pipelight-plugin  --enable unity3d
Ubuntu uses another process, most recommended for beginners, but this can not be done in porteus.
